From a79b4db06a3f9cc76aa68049dafe2cd2caa564b4 Mon Sep 17 00:00:00 2001 From: tmashuang Date: Tue, 12 Sep 2017 14:14:24 -0700 Subject: E2E testing with selenium --- package.json |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'package.json') diff --git a/package.json b/package.json index 12f79ba35..7a1c4b6d2 100644 --- a/package.json +++ b/package.json @@ -11,6 +11,7 @@ "dist": "npm run clear && npm install && gulp dist", "test": "npm run lint && npm run test-unit && npm run test-integration", "test-unit": "METAMASK_ENV=test mocha --require test/helper.js --recursive \"test/unit/**/*.js\"", + "test-e2e": "METAMASK_ENV=test mocha test/e2e/metamask.spec --recursive || true", "single-test": "METAMASK_ENV=test mocha --require test/helper.js", "test-integration": "npm run buildMock && npm run buildCiUnits && karma start", "test-coverage": "nyc npm run test-unit && if [ $COVERALLS_REPO_TOKEN ]; then nyc report --reporter=text-lcov | coveralls; fi", @@ -167,7 +168,7 @@ "gulp-watch": "^4.3.5", "gulp-zip": "^4.0.0", "isomorphic-fetch": "^2.2.1", - "jsdom": "^11.1.0", + "jsdom": "^11.2.0", "jsdom-global": "^3.0.2", "jshint-stylish": "~2.2.1", "json-rpc-engine": "^3.0.1", @@ -190,6 +191,7 @@ "react-addons-test-utils": "^15.5.1", "react-test-renderer": "^15.5.4", "react-testutils-additions": "^15.2.0", + "selenium-webdriver": "^3.5.0", "sinon": "^3.2.0", "tape": "^4.5.1", "testem": "^1.10.3", -- cgit